>> No.9483293

>>9483148
.sfc files are SNES ROMs, like .smc. He messed it up and added that tilde at the end. Just remove the tilde and then you can load the game.

>> No.9490036

>>9488364
I agree. I dislike how the modern hack venn diagram of
>High production value, high quality level design, new .asm and level gimmicks while remaining pretty faithful to the core Mario playstyle
>Not Kaizo
is practically two completely separate circles these days. The only really great stuff that fall under both feels pretty limited and I've only seen:
>JUMP and JUMP1/2
>YUMP 2
>TSRPR
>Plumber for All Seasons
>Mice series
>Nachos and Fried Oreos
A lot of other stuff just feels either dated or too different from traditional Mario. Maybe I'm just not seeing enough of the good stuff but it feels like every hack worth a damn these days is a Kaizo. I don't even really mind Kaizo either because I like a good few (Luminescent for instance is great) but it feels so overbearing now.

>> No.9490746

>>9490730
honestly, i feel like a lot of Jump is kaizo too. "Kaizo with powerups". I dont like the idea of standard levels being as strict as kaizo levels with damage forgiveness.
But this is exactly why i said earlier i think kaizo level design is easier to make. kaizo levels you just force the player to do what you want, so you know exactly what the player is going to get. in a true standard level, they're a bit more open and have multiple ways to get around an obstacle, but how do you make that good and consistent? I do wish more people tried making Standard, but it's not easy
